Buenavista All-Lights Village Fisherfolks Association was visited by the Municipal Agriculturist and the newly Appointed Chairperson on Agriculture and Fisheries in Barangay Buenavista
The Municipal Agriculture Office led by Chief visited the Buenavista All-Lights Village Fisherfolks Association to update their preparation for the Solar Powered Livelihood Center construction. There was a delay in the construction due to the changes in the leadership of the Association, the changes in the leadership of Barangay Buenavista, and the decline of the first donor of the land due to confidential reasons.
The Barangay Buenavista Chairperson of Agriculture and Fisheries met the officers to check on the next donor of the land where to construct the project.
The new President will donate a piece of land for the livelihood center. He was not in the meeting because he is attending training for the Sustainable Livelihood Program of DSWD.
